Role Responsibilities

 

The Executive Support (ES) to the Assistant Deputy Minister's Office (ADMO) plays a vital role in ensuring the smooth operation of the ADMO. This position requires not only managing the ADM’s schedule, coordinating meetings, and preparing essential materials, but also demands a high level of political acumen and the ability to work in a fast-paced, dynamic environment.

 

The Executive Support (ES) is responsible for following job duties (but not limited to):

  • Maintaining the calendar, scheduling appointments, coordinating, planning and organizing Division’s business events, booking facilities, making travel arrangements for the ADM and resolving any issues as they arise.
  • Liaising with both the Deputy Minister and Minister’s offices, ensuring that communications and priorities are effectively aligned across the senior leadership team
  • Researching and preparing background material for executive meetings. 
  • Monitoring, tracking, and negotiating timelines for ADMO related matters. 
  • Responding directly to day-to-day administrative inquiries on behalf of the ADMO.
  • Assisting in the financial aspects for the office of the ADMO in accordance with established legislation, regulations, policies and directives.
  • Plays a central role in supporting the achievement of strategic priorities, ensuring the effective execution of administrative and operational tasks, and contributing to the overall success of the ADMO.
  • Acting as a Service Request Coordinator for the ADMO team, providing support to the branch managers and staff with IT equipment, software, network accessibility and other technological equipment and systems. 
  • Acting as a resource to other administrative support staff within the division and/or department by providing advice and assistance on matters relating to the ADM office. 
  • Supports human resource requirements for the ADMO, including 1GX and WPA status.
  • Liaises with Pay and Benefits on salary, benefits, and time accounting records, supporting the ADMO
  • Receiving and processing highly confidential and sensitive information and demonstrating excellent interpersonal and oral and written communication skills. Providing support in a highly professional manner with a high degree of autonomy, diplomacy, and confidentiality.
  • Responding effectively and knowledgeably to emerging issues and taking appropriate, and often independent action, within appropriate guidelines.

 

To be successful in this role, you will demonstrate:

  • Strong leadership, management 
  • Project planning skills.
  • Strong understanding of administrative and operational service policies, guidelines and standards.
  • Strong organizational and priority-setting skills with the ability to manage multiple issues at any given time.

Qualifications

 

Requirements:

  • High School Diploma
  • Four years progressively responsible related experience working in an Executive’s office.

 

Equivalency: Directly related education or experience considered on the basis of: 

  • One year of education for one year of experience; or 
  • One year of experience for one year of education.

 

Assets:

  • Proficiency with MS Office applications, Visio, SharePoint, ARTS, 1GX, BERNIE.
  • Experience with ARTS, System Applications and Products (SAP) systems, invoicing, budgets, contract administration, ordering office supplies and managing inventory.
  • High degree of functional independence in handling a wide variety of assignments from different branch staff, often with high volume and high urgency and confidentiality, which adds to the complexity and requires creative solutions in order to complete the work assigned.
  • Experience in managing complex calendar, scheduling appointments, organizing and booking meetings, coordinating accommodation and making travel arrangements.
  • Experience in coordinating, compiling briefing notes, documents and reports for senior management.
